Output 35ebd8b9fbbb0094ac18f9a9d2fdce215962241d61951413486c0920ed33e59e:0

value
1999545
script pubkey
OP_0 OP_PUSHBYTES_20 8f634cee4efffe5c4b99b97c5d160d46c87a9801
address
tb1q3a35emjwlll9cjueh97969sdgmy84xqp8e9hvw
transaction
35ebd8b9fbbb0094ac18f9a9d2fdce215962241d61951413486c0920ed33e59e
confirmations
15258
spent
true